/*** AGWPE interface description from Xastir + AGWPE documents.
*** As those documents are unclear, I am using Xastir to supply
*** clue as to what really needs to be done.
// How to Start your application and register with AGW Packet Engine
// First of all create a stream socket and connect with
// AGW Packet Engine ip address at port 8000.
// If your application is running at the same machine with
// AGWPE then as ip address use localhost (127.0.0.1).
//
// After connecting you need to register your application's
// callsign if your application need to establish AX.25 connections.
// If your application just do monitoring and sends Unproto frames,
// no need for callsign registration.
// You can register as many as 100 different callsigns.
// If you register a callsign then AGW Packet Engine accepts AX.25
// connections for this call.
// You then ask AGWPE to send you the radioport information.
// How many radioports are with their description.
// After that you can create your windows or anything else.
//
// Now you are ready.
// If you wish to do monitoring then you must enable monitoring.
// Transmit a special frame in Raw AX25 format
//
// The frame must be in RAW AX25 format as should be txed by
// the modem (no need for bit stuffing etc)
// You can use this function to tx for instance an unproto
// frame with a special PID or any other frame different from normal AX25 Format.
//
// Port field is the port where we want the data to tx
// DataKind field = MAKELONG('K',0); The ASCII value of letter K
// CallFrom empty (NULL)
// CallTo empty (NULL)
// DataLen is the length of the data that follow
// USER is Undefined
//
// the whole frame with the header is
//
// [ HEADER ]
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ER][Data ]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es DataLen Bytes
//
// ASK RadioPorts Number and descriptions
//
// Port field must be 0
// DataKind field =MAKELONG('G',0); The ASCII value of letter G
// CallFrom is empty (NULL)
// CallTo is empty(NULL)
// DataLen must be 0
// USER is undefined
// No data field must exists
// [ HEADER ]
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es
//
// ASK To start receiving AX25 RAW Frames
//
// Sending again thos command will disable this service.
// You can start and stop this service any times you needed
//
// Port field no needed set it to 0
// DataKind field =MAKELONG('k',0); The ASCII value of lower case letter k
// CallFrom is empty no needed
// CallTo is empty no needed
// DataLen must be 0
// USER is undefined
// No data field must be present
//
// the whole frame with the header is
//
// [ HEADER ]
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es
// Raw AX25 Frames
//
// You can receive RAW AX25 frames if you enable this service.
// Those frames are all the packet valid frames received from
// any radioport. The frame is exactly the same as the pure
// AX25 frame with the follow additions.
//
// The first byte always contains the radioport number 0 for 1st radioport.
// There is no FCS field at the end of the frame.
// There is no bit stuffing.
// The LOWORD Port field is the port which heard the frame
// The LOWORD DataKind field ='K'; The ASCII value of letter K
// CallFrom the callsign of the station who TX the frame(Source station)
// CallTo The callsign of the destination station
// DataLen is the length of the DATA field(the length of the frame
// USER is undefined.
// the whole frame with the header is
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ER][DATA ]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es DataLen Bytes
// 1.UNPROTO monitor frame
//
// The LOWORD Port field is the port which heard the frame
// The LOWORD DataKind field ='U'; The ASCII value of letter U
// CallFrom= is the call from the station we heard the Packet
// CallTo =is the destination call (CQ,BEACON etc)
// DataLen= is the length of the data that follow
// the whole frame with the header is
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ER][Data ]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es DataLen Bytes
// 4.RadioPort information
//
// The LOWORD Port field is always 0
// The LOWORD DataKind field ='G'; The ASCII value of letter G
// CallFrom empty(NULL)
// CallTo empty(NULL)
// DataLen is the length of the data that follow
// USER is undefined
// the whole frame with the header is
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ER][Data ]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es DataLen Bytes
// the data field format is as follow in plain text
// howmany ports ;1st radioport description;2nd radioport;....;last radioport describtion
// like
// 2;TNC2 on serialport 1;OE5DXL on serialport2;
// We have here 2 radioports. The separator is the ';'
// 10. Reply to a 'G' command. This frame returns the radioport number
// and description
//
// Port field is always 0
// LOWORD DataKind field ='G'. The ASCII value of letter G
// CallFrom is empty (NULL)
// CallTo is empty(NULL)
// DataLen =The number of bytes of DATA field
// USER is undefined
// DATA field conatins the radioport description
// [ HEADER ]
// [port][DataKind][CallFrom][CallTo ][DataLen][USER] [DATA]
// 4bytes 4bytes 10bytes 10bytes 4bytes 4bytes Datalen bytes.
//
// The DATA field is organised as follow and is in plain ASCII.
//
// Number of Radioports;First radioport description(Friendlyname);Second radioport description(Friendly name)...........
//
// Number of radioports=a Decimal Value. A value of 3 means 3 radioports
// Radioport description= A string that describes the radioport.
// The separator between fields is the letter ';'.
// Just parse the whole DATA field and use as separator the ';'
//
// Xastir parses integer data like this: That is, it is LITTLE ENDIAN
//
// Fetch the length of the data portion of the packet
// data_length = (unsigned char)(input_string[31]);
// data_length = (data_length << 8) + (unsigned char)(input_string[30]);
// data_length = (data_length << 8) + (unsigned char)(input_string[29]);
// data_length = (data_length << 8) + (unsigned char)(input_string[28]);
//
***/
